
Who are Die Antwoord? Or, more to the point, is Die Antwoord? “The answer,” MC Ninja, the band’s front guy with the WW2 razor sharp crop, answers here. The answer to what? Silence, then, “Whatever, man. Fuck.”
Their video, ‘Enter The Ninja’, went viral and before long it became a blogger’s quest to uncover the truth. Were Die Antwoord serious? Was it considered ironic to like them because you were ‘in’ on the joke? Did MC Ninja posses the world’s worst tattoos? Maybe, Maybe, Yes.
Die Antwoord are three people; MC Ninja, Yo-Landi Vis$$er and DJ Hi-Tek and have been together since 2009. That’s pretty much all I know. I also know that on paper Die Antwoord seem like shit. And then you listen to their music and you realise that they actually are the shit. Self confidence with extra lashings of insane rapping interwoven with their local Afrikaans slang with seriously intense beats sounds like a recipe for disaster. And yet, strangely, it’s not. At all.
On ‘Enter The Ninja’ Ninja actually stops the song to declare that his own song, is, in fact, “like the coolest song I ever heard in my whole life.” I admit, when I first watched the video my first thought was, WTF. Swiftly followed by, WTF I NEED TO WATCH THAT AGAIN. Followed by, WHERE CAN I SEE ANOTHER VIDEO.
